How accurate is greedy algorithm

A greedy algorithm is any algorithm that follows the problem-solving heuristic of making the locally optimal choice at each stage. In many problems, a greedy strategy does not produce an optimal solution, but a greedy heuristic can yield locally optimal solutions that approximate a globally optimal solution in a … Ver mais Greedy algorithms produce good solutions on some mathematical problems, but not on others. Most problems for which they work will have two properties: Greedy choice property We can make whatever choice … Ver mais Greedy algorithms can be characterized as being 'short sighted', and also as 'non-recoverable'. They are ideal only for problems that have … Ver mais Greedy algorithms typically (but not always) fail to find the globally optimal solution because they usually do not operate exhaustively on all the data. They can make … Ver mais • Mathematics portal • Best-first search • Epsilon-greedy strategy • Greedy algorithm for Egyptian fractions • Greedy source Ver mais Greedy algorithms have a long history of study in combinatorial optimization and theoretical computer science. Greedy heuristics are known to produce suboptimal results on many problems, and so natural questions are: • For … Ver mais • The activity selection problem is characteristic of this class of problems, where the goal is to pick the maximum number of activities that do not clash with each other. Ver mais • "Greedy algorithm", Encyclopedia of Mathematics, EMS Press, 2001 [1994] • Gift, Noah. "Python greedy coin example". Ver mais WebGreedy algorithms tend to be made up of five components. These components include: A candidate set from which a solution is created. A selection function, which picks the best candidate that will be added to the solution. A feasibility function. This is used to determine whether a candidate can be used to contribute to a solution.

What is the Greedy Algorithm? - Medium

WebThis video on the Greedy Algorithm will acquaint you with all the fundamentals of greedy programming paradigm. In this tutorial, you will learn 'What Is Gree... WebA greedy Algorithm is a special type of algorithm that is used to solve optimization problems by deriving the maximum or minimum values for the particular instance. This algorithm selects the optimum result feasible for the present scenario independent of subsequent results. The greedy algorithm is often implemented for condition-specific ... how to string wine corks https://prime-source-llc.com

Algorithms Design Techniques - GeeksforGeeks

Web24 de jan. de 2024 · 1. The Greedy algorithm follows the path B -> C -> D -> H -> G which has the cost of 18, and the heuristic algorithm follows the path B -> E -> F -> H -> G which has the cost 25. This specific example … Web14 de abr. de 2024 · In Theorem 3, we show the greedy solution has a bounded number of groups and offers a bounded noise for the FPRC problem. Theorem 3. If d is the largest degree of a node in the complement graph \(G_c\), then Algorithm 2 returns at most \(d+1\) groups. Proof. We focus on a data owner u with degree d (the maximum degree in the … Web15 de fev. de 2024 · Classification by Design Method: There are primarily three main categories into which an algorithm can be named in this type of classification. They are: Greedy Method: In the greedy method, at each step, a decision is made to choose the local optimum, without thinking about the future consequences. Example: Fractional … reading comprehension in filipino grade 4

Remote Sensing Free Full-Text A Nonlinear Radiometric …

Category:Power BI - How to Create Calculated Columns? - GeeksforGeeks

Tags:How accurate is greedy algorithm

How accurate is greedy algorithm

Breadth First Search vs Greedy Algorithm - Stack Overflow

WebThe Greedy algorithm uses some of the same principles but can end up with a significantly... The most efficient and effective way to find a path is A* (A-Star). Web4.1 Greedy Algorithm. Greedy algorithms are widely used to address the test-case prioritization problem, which focus on always selecting the current “best” test case during …

How accurate is greedy algorithm

Did you know?

Web5 de fev. de 2024 · Step 2: Filtering the data. Data in Power BI is often unorganized, un-filtered, and messy, so to make accurate reports in Power BI you will need to organize, and filter the data in Power Query Editor.In Power Query Editor you need to perform some basic filtration like removing unwanted columns, removing black, and reassigning datatypes (if … WebA greedy algorithm, on the other hand, is what you described: an algorithm that tries to find the best solution by selecting the best option at every step. That's pretty much it. This doesn't imply anything about the solution: sometimes a greedy algorithm provides the perfect and optimal solution, while some other times it may just be an heuristic -> …

WebCalifornia State University, SacramentoSpring 2024Algorithms by Ghassan ShobakiText book: Introduction to Algorithms by Cormen, Leiserson, Rivest, and Stein... Web22 de jul. de 2024 · What is a greedy algorithm? You must have heard about a lot of algorithmic design techniques while sifting through some of the articles here. Some of them are: Brute Force Divide and Conquer Greedy Programming Dynamic Programming to name a few. In this article, you will learn about what a greedy algorithm is and how you can …

Web30 de ago. de 2024 · Welcome to another video! In this video, I am going to cover greedy algorithms. Specifically, what a greedy algorithm is and how to create a greedy algorithm... Web24 de mar. de 2024 · Greedy Algorithm. An algorithm used to recursively construct a set of objects from the smallest possible constituent parts. Given a set of integers (, , ..., ) …

WebGreedy Algorithms Pedro Ribeiro DCC/FCUP 2024/2024 Pedro Ribeiro (DCC/FCUP) Greedy Algorithms 2024/2024 1 / 47. Greedy Algorithms A greedy algorithm is an algorithm that follows the problem solving heuristic of making the locally optimal choice at each stage with the hope of nding a global optimum.

Web30 de jun. de 2024 · The term "greedy algorithm" refers to algorithms that solve optimization problems. BFS is not specifically for solving optimization problems, so it doesn't make sense (i.e., it's not even wrong) to say that BFS is a greedy algorithm unless you are applying it to an optimization problem. In that case, the statement is true or not … reading comprehension in sanskritWeb23 de fev. de 2024 · The problematic part for a greedy algorithm is analyzing its accuracy. Even with the proper solution, it is difficult to demonstrate why it is accurate. … how to stringstream a string to intWeb23 de jun. de 2016 · Input: A set U of integers, an integer k. Output: A set X ⊆ U of size k whose sum is as large as possible. There's a natural greedy algorithm for this problem: … reading comprehension job eslWebThis video on the Greedy Algorithm will acquaint you with all the fundamentals of greedy programming paradigm. In this tutorial, you will learn 'What Is Gree... reading comprehension informal assessmentWebA greedy algorithm is a simple, intuitive algorithm that is used in optimization problems. The algorithm makes the optimal choice at each step as it attempts to find the overall … reading comprehension in science educationWebAlgorithm #1: order the jobs by decreasing value of ( P [i] - T [i] ) Algorithm #2: order the jobs by decreasing value of ( P [i] / T [i] ) For simplicity we are assuming that there are no … reading comprehension in grade 5Web24 de mar. de 2024 · Epsilon () Epsilon () parameter is related to the epsilon-greedy action selection procedure in the Q-learning algorithm. In the action selection step, we select the specific action based on the Q … reading comprehension in present simple